MARION COUNTY – POSTCARD HISTORY SERIES
By Randy Winland
Published 2017, Softcover, Illustrated, 128 pp.
Marion County is home to seven incorporated villages as well as several other small communities. While the history of these locales may not be as well-known as the city of Marion, each still has a vibrant past that deserves to be remembered.
Local author and historian Randy Winland has compiled more than 200 postcard images from
his collection, as well as those of several other Marion area collectors, to compile a unique look back at the history of Marion County’s villages and communities. The book is divided into chapters focusing on Caledonia and Claridon Area; Green Camp and New Bloomington Area; Kirkpatrick and Martel Area; LaRue Area; Meeker and Morral Area; Prospect Area; and Waldo Area.
Many of the views are real-photo postcards which are actually pictures printed on a special postcard stock. These views may literally have been “one-of- a-kind” creations.
